Akuma ("Devil",, Japanese) is a demonic entity in the body of Gouki ("Great Demon", Japanese), brother to Gouken, former sesei of Ryu and Ken. He, like Ryu, wanders the Earth in search of suitable competition. He seeks to eliminate all those who know the secret of the origin of his powers. He also seeks a final, fatal confrontation with Ryu, the only person alive that can possibly be his equal, and seeks to draw out his hidden potential so that the two may clash in a bloody, hellish battle, the only thing that can satisfy his bloodthirsty inclinations.
Akuma is the embodiment of an evil entity which held the key to a fearsome power called the Messatsu, which was sealed by a martial artist known as Goutetsu. The Shotokan fighting style which Goutetsu was trained with allowed its practitioners to kill with a mere strike. The secret of this deadly technique was the focusing of the powerful forces of destruction, called forth by beckoning the power of Akuma. Goutestu decided to banish the use of this, the Messatsu killing blow, and taught his two young sons, Gouken and Gouki a gentler version of the Shotokan arts he was trained in. However, it was apparent that Gouki was ruled by his emotions, and often fought with rage, while Gouken fought with a calm spirit. This rashness embedded into Gouki's character was his downfall, as he often trained in the forest, attempting to unearth and discover the secret techniques on his own. Upon venturing into the forest, he heard a distinct voice call out his name, beckoning him. He followed the call to a mysterious cave. Entering the cave, the voice asked him if he wished to learn all the secrets of Shotokan and be better than his brother. Not thinking of the consequences, Gouki agreed to the voices demands, and his body was taken over by the demonic force known only as Akuma. Returning home, he slaughtered his father Goutetsu with the Messatsu. Going through his father's belongings, he also learned that there was another who knew of the murderous powers, a man with whom Goutetsu sometimes trained, his friend Gen. But first, he sought out his brother, Gouken. Gouken and Gen were the only two alive who were aware of the secrets behind the evil power of the Messatsu killing technique.
After the first Street Fighter tournament, Ryu and Ken returned to Gouken's dojo to train. But they found their master locked in combat with Akuma high up in the mountains. They watched the apparent slaughter of their master with the Messatsu killing technique, the Raging Demon. Akuma merely swatted the boys aside as they attempted to avenge the death of their master, and told them to seek him out when they were strong enough.
He then proceeded to seek out the man known as Gen, in order to protect his secret from being discovered. In the first Alpha tournament, he watched from the shadows, but it was not till the second tournament that he met up with competition. He found Gen, and the two fought a cataclysmic duel. For a time, neither was able to gain advantage over the other. Finally, Gen admitted that he could not defeat Akuma. Gen's resolve weakened, and Akuma attacked him with all of his ferocity. Gen had lost, but surprisingly, Akuma permitted him to live as long as he told no one of his secret...Akuma realized that there were other worthy competitors in this world, as he came face to face with Ryu. In a valiant struggle, Ryu and Akuma fought to a standstill. Weakened by his battle with Gen, Akuma decided to retreat for now. Akuma told him that he had the potential to awaken the same great powers that Akuma himself possessed. He told Ryu to seek him out when he was strong enough, and proceeded to destroy his cave, to protect his secret yet again. Akuma realized that there were indeed powerful humans on Earth, such as Ryu, Gen, and M. Bison, who were perhaps capable of defeating him...
Akuma lurked in the shadows during the second Street Fighter tournament, watching until the man whom wished his presence was alone. Unfortunately for M. Bison, he wanted to try to lure Akuma out with the second Street Fighter tournament in hopes of turning him to the side of the Shadowloo. But Akuma found Bison at an inopportune time, as Bison, awakening from the ShoRyuKen which Ryu defeated him with, awoke to the sight of Akuma standing over him. Akuma allegedly used the Shun Goku Satsu on Bison, and left him for dead...
Akuma entered the third Street Fighter tournament to test his skills. He again sought to fight Ryu, and see if he had reached his full potential as of yet. His bloodlust had taken him around the world in search of more competition, but the demonic force within had now taken full control, and had unleashed the most deadly fighting technique attainable by destructive forces, the Kon Goku RetsuZan. Akuma knew that it would be only a matter of time before Ryu was ready for their final confrontation, as he watched from the shadows...
